Conclusion
-
1.
The spiropyrans investigated have a weakly pronounced bipolar structure of the colored form and are characterized by anomalously high activation parameters of the thermal reaction in toluene solutions.
-
2.
The change in the shape of the spectrum in the process of photo-activation and the anomalous parameters of the decoloration reaction are due to the formation of associates of the colored form in toluene solutions.
